Little Kingsley farmstay, cottage on a little farm 1hr from Sydney & Wollongong
Perfect for a winter getaway with our cosy slow combustion wood fire inside and our fire pit outside. This beautiful two bedroom cottage accommodation is situated on part of our ten acre rural property with views of the dam and overlooking the paddocks where our sheep and cows roam freely. The property is partly surrounded by natural Australian bush which is home to kangaroos, cockatoos, kookaburras and many more varieties of Australian animals. The cottage is well appointed with a large kitchen including dishwasher and microwave and the living area has a slow combustion wood fire to keep you warm and cozy in the winter while enjoying a glass of red or cup of hot chocolate. The cottage also has ducted air conditioning to keep you cool in the summer. The large outdoor area includes a gas barbeque and outdoor dining as well as a long bench with bar stools where you can just sit, watch the cows grazing and enjoy the scenery. We are located just 2.5 kms from Thirlmere township and the NSW Train Museum which offers steam train rides every weekend and regular visits from Thomas the Tank Engine and is also home to the Steam Train Festival which is held annually in March. Thirlmere Lakes National Park and the spectacular Mermaid Pools and Potholes are within a ten minute drive with many bushwalking trails and swimming holes. Cedar Creek orchard is a five minute drive away where you can pick your own seasonal fruit and they also offer apple juice, cider and honey for sale, check their website for bookings and dates. Whether you want to just get away from it all, relax and unwind or bring the family and checkout the local attractions. We are only about an hours drive from Sydney and about half an hour from Bowral and the Southern Highlands, perfect for a family getaway or a romantic weekend. Also only 50 minutes drive from the Wollongong beaches.
